Kids design and build their own skateboards thanks to local non-profit
Nine Kingsbridge Community College students were given a day out at Outside Devon thanks to a grant and a local non-profit.
South Hams Area Wellbeing organised a day at Outside Devon in Bantham for nine Year 8 and 9 Kingsbridge Community College students with thanks to the Normal Family Charitable Trust.
A spokesperson for SHAW posted on social media said: "They designed and built their own skateboards, had lunch in the cafe, then had tuition in skateboarding. Most of them had never been on a skateboard before, but by the end of the day they all tackled the very large and complicated skate bowl confidently. Well done to the students and everybody at Outside."
The Norman Family Charitable Trust has been supporting charities and other non-profit groups in the South West of England since 1979 and has awarded over 11,000 grants totalling over £11 million.
